Eyebrow window installation involves integrating small, horizontal windows directly into the upper part of a wall, often just below the roofline or ceiling. These windows are designed to bring in natural light and improve the overall appearance of a space without sacrificing privacy or wall space. The installation process typically includes measuring the designated area, creating an opening in the wall, and fitting the window securely to ensure proper insulation and functionality. This service is ideal for homeowners looking to enhance their interior lighting or add architectural interest to rooms like attics, stairwells, or upper-level hallways.
Many property owners turn to eyebrow window installation to address common issues such as dark, poorly lit rooms or spaces that lack sufficient natural light. These windows can also help improve ventilation in areas that are hard to reach with traditional windows. Additionally, eyebrow windows can add a distinctive aesthetic element, increasing curb appeal and giving rooms a more open, airy feel. They are particularly useful in homes with limited wall space or where traditional window placement is not feasible due to structural or design constraints.

The overview below groups typical Eyebrow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Norristown, PA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or eyebrow window repairs or replacements range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and window size.
Full Window Replacement - Replacing an entire eyebrow window with new materials usually costs between $1,200 and $3,500. Larger, more complex projects can reach $4,000 or more, but most fall into the mid-tier range.
Custom or Architectural Designs - Installing custom-shaped or decorative eyebrow windows can vary widely, often from $2,000 to $5,000 or higher. These projects are less common and tend to be on the higher end of the cost spectrum.
Labor and Permitting - Local contractors typically charge between $100 and $250 per hour for installation work. Additional costs for permits or structural modifications may add to the overall expense, depending on project compl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are eyebrow windows? Eyebrow windows are small, arched windows installed near the roofline that add natural light and architectural interest to a space.
Can eyebrow window installation be done on existing structures? Yes, local contractors can often incorporate eyebrow windows into existing buildings to enhance aesthetics and lighting.
What styles of eyebrow windows are available? There are various styles, including different arch shapes, sizes, and framing options to match the property's design.
Are there any building code considerations for eyebrow windows? Local service providers are familiar with regional building codes and can ensure installations meet necessary regulations.
